Job Summary
Welcome assigned patients, evaluate vascular access for patency, and perform cannulation and heparin administration as delegated. Initiate dialysis treatment by monitoring blood and dialysate flow, obtaining vital signs, and evaluating intradialytic problems. Document pre- and post-treatment evaluations, weights, and treatment parameters on the Hemodialysis Treatment Sheet. Assist in training direct patient care staff, maintaining a clean environment, and ensuring compliance with infection control policies. Follow newly admitted patients through their first four weeks in the Transitional Care Unit, coordinating care and demonstrating home dialysis setups.
Required Qualifications
- High School diploma or G.E.D.
- Must meet Center for Medicaid/Medicare Services (CMS)-approved state and/or national certification requirements within the required state or CMS timeline
- All appropriate state licensure, education, and training (if any) required
- Demonstrated commitment to organization culture, values, and customer service standards
- Successful completion of the organization dialysis training program
- Successful completion of CPR certification
- Must be able to lift and to lower solutions on a frequent basis of up to 30 lbs., and on an occasional lift basis up to 40 lbs., as high as 5 feet
- Must be able to bend over
- Must be able to exert up to 15 pounds of force
- Must be able to push and/or pull equipment
- Must be able to perform frequent, prolonged periods of standing
- Must be able to travel between assigned facilities and various locations within the community
- Must be able to travel to regional, Business Unit and Corporate meetings
- Must pass the Ishihara's Color Blindness test
Desired Qualifications
- Previous patient care experience in a hospital setting or a related facility
